If the game prompts you on whether you want your runner to try and take an extra base, what it's really asking you is if you want to override the better judgment of your base coach. By design, the runner is usually going to get thrown out if you take that option, even if the ball is "very deep" and the fielder has a "poor" arm. If the runner is likely to make it safely to the next base, he attempts it without prompting you about it. The prompt is to cover extreme situations--once in a while you might want to send the runner even if you know he's going to get thrown out 80% of the time.
The one exception to this, for whatever reason, is sac flies: if the ball is reasonably deep and the runner isn't an ice wagon, he'll make it home safely more often than not.
